Reflex Drive, a deep tech startup from India has chosen energy gadgets from Infineon Applied sciences AG for its next-generation motor management options for unmanned aerial automobiles (UAVs). By integrating Infineon’s OptiMOS 80 V and 100 V, Reflex Drive’s electrical velocity controllers (ESCs) obtain improved thermal administration and better effectivity, enabling excessive energy density in a compact footprint. Moreover, the usage of Infineon’s MOTIX IMD701 controller answer which mixes the XMC1404 microcontroller with the MOTIX 6EDL7141 3-phase gate driver IC delivers compact, exact, and dependable motor management. This permits improved efficiency, better reliability, and longer flight occasions for UAVs.

Reflex Drives’s ESCs with field-oriented management (FOC) provide improved motor effectivity and exact management, whereas its high-performance BLDC motors are designed for optimized flight management and allow predictive upkeep of drive techniques. Weighing solely 180 g and with a compact quantity of 120 cm³, the ESCs can ship steady energy output of three.8 kW (12S/48 V, 80 A steady). On account of their light-weight design, strong energy output, and constant FOC management – even beneath demanding climate situations – make them excellent for motors within the thrust vary from 15 to twenty kg. Subsequently, they’re notably appropriate for drone functions within the fields of agricultural spraying know-how, seed dispersal, small-scale logistics, and items transport.
